Educational Software For Student Engagement

Educational software for student engagement refers to digital tools and platforms designed to actively involve students in the learning process. These programs utilize interactive activities, gamification, multimedia content, and real-time feedback to foster motivation, participation, and deep understanding among learners across various age groups and subjects.

Key Features

  • Interactive Lessons and Activities
  • Gamification Elements (badges, points, leaderboards)
  • Real-time Feedback and Assessments
  • Multimedia Content Integration (videos, animations, simulations)
  • Personalized Learning Paths
  • Collaborative Tools for Group Work
  • Progress Tracking and Reporting
  • Accessibility Features for Diverse Learners

Pros

  • Enhances student motivation and interest in learning
  • Encourages active participation rather than passive reception
  • Provides immediate feedback for better understanding
  • Supports diverse learning styles with multimedia options
  • Facilitates data collection on student performance for educators

Cons

  • Potential reliance on technology that may widen the digital divide
  • Requires training for teachers to effectively implement tools
  • Overemphasis on gamification might overshadow core learning objectives
  • Possible technical issues or software bugs disrupting lessons
  • Limited effectiveness if not integrated thoughtfully into curriculum
